Can anyone help me figure out why my brake lights stay on when the car is off? It keeps draining the battery...95 accord tail lights -- posted image.

My civic did the same thing. Lay on the floor and look up at the brake pedal, find the switch, and check to make sure the pedal is depressing the plunger of the switch. I had to silicone a penny to my brake pedal to push the plunger when the break was released.
